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Lohnzuschläge ermitteln nach Uhrzeiten und Tag

Forumthread: Lohnzuschläge ermitteln nach Uhrzeiten und Tag

Lohnzuschläge ermitteln nach Uhrzeiten und Tag
08.10.2019 17:16:27
Matthias
Liebe Excel-Profis,
ich habe keine Idee, wie ich das lösen kann. Abhängig von Arbetsbeginn und Arbeitsende will ich aus einer Tabelle die Zuschläge ermitteln. Zur Berechnung will den Arbeitsbeginn, das Arbeitsende und die Pausendauer heranziehen. Das soll dann aus der Tabelle automatisch rechnen. Ein Zuschlag von 1 bedeutet hier dann Normalstunde.
Damit ich sicherer Rechnen kann, verwende ich Datum&Zeit für die Zellen.
Ich habe die Beispieldatei beigefügt: https://www.herber.de/bbs/user/132415.xlsx
Sie sieht so aus:
von_____bis_____total Pausenzeit
Sa 17:30 So 02:30 09:00 00:45
Konditionen Zuschläge nach Arbeitsstunden
Beginn___Ende____ 0:00 3:00 7:00 8:00 09:00
Mo 00:00 Mo 05:59 1,25 1,25 1,25 1,25 1,50
Mo 06:00 Mo 21:59 1,00 1,00 1,00 1,25 1,50
Mo 22:00 Di 05:59 1,25 1,25 1,25 1,25 1,50
Di 06:00 Di 21:59 1,00 1,00 1,00 1,25 1,50
Di 22:00 Mi 05:59 1,25 1,25 1,25 1,25 1,50
Mi 06:00 Mi 21:59 1,00 1,00 1,00 1,25 1,50
Mi 22:00 Do 05:59 1,25 1,25 1,25 1,25 1,50
Do 06:00 Do 21:59 1,00 1,00 1,00 1,25 1,50
Do 22:00 Fr 05:59 1,25 1,25 1,25 1,25 1,50
Fr 06:00 Fr 21:59 1,00 1,00 1,00 1,25 1,50
Fr 22:00 Sa 23:59 1,25 1,40 1,50 1,50 1,50
So 00:00 Mo 00:00 1,50 1,50 1,50 1,50 1,50
Mo 00:00 Mo 06:00 1,25 1,25 1,25 1,25 1,50
Die Herausforderung: die Arbeitszeiten können die Bereiche überlappen...
Ich habe es schon mit Verweis probiert oder verschiedenen wenn-Bedingungen, aber bisher nichts gelöst. Ginge es mit einer Matrix-Funktion und wen ja, wie?
Ich freue mich auf Hinweise!!!
Vielen Dank schon einmal, LG, Papavonmaxi
Anzeige

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Lohnzuschläge ermitteln nach Uhrzeiten und Tag
08.10.2019 17:38:25
Daniel
Hi
mal ne Idee:
1. erstelle die Liste für jede Stunde jeden Tag der Woche von Montag bis einschließlich nächster Montag
(für jede Stunde eine Zeile)
2. verwende als Datum in der ersten Spalte die die Kombination aus 1 bis 8 + Uhrzeit (Wochentag als Zahl + Uhrzeit
die 8 dann für den Montag in der Folgewoche
3. schreibe für jede Stunde einzeln den Zuschlag auf
4. wandle Start- und Endtermin nach dem Schema um: =Wochentag(Datum)+Uhrzeit
5. ermittle mit der Vergleichs-Funktion die Zeilennummer für Start- und Endtermin in der Liste
6. bilde die Summe zwischen diesen beiden Zeilennummern in der jeweiligen Spalte
ist zwar ein bisschen "brute-Force", aber per Formel allein das Thema "übergreifende Bereiche" abzudecken ist auch sehr aufwendig.
wenn du eine Arbeitszeit von Sonntag auf Montag hast, musst du beim Montag zum Wochentag (7) noch 1 hinzuaddieren.
Gruß Daniel
Anzeige
AW: Lohnzuschläge ermitteln nach Uhrzeiten und Tag
08.10.2019 17:43:35
onur
Bist du dir sicher?
Normalerweise heben sich Zuschläge nicht gegenseitig auf - soll heissen:
25% Nachtzuschlag 22:00-6:00
25% Samstagszuschlag 00:00-23:59
50% Sonntagszuschlag 00:00-23:59
25% Überstundenzuschlag für die Stunden über 8,00 Stunden.
Wenn Jemand von Samstag 22:00 bis Sonntag 7:00 arbeitet, bekommt er für die ersten beiden Stunden 50% (Samstags- und Nachtzuschlag), für die Zeit von 00:00 bis 6:00 75% Zuschlag (Sonntags- und Nachtzuschlag)
und für die letzte Stunde 75 % (Sonntags- und Überstundenzuschlag) Zuschläge.
Anzeige
AW: Lohnzuschläge ermitteln nach Uhrzeiten und Tag
08.10.2019 17:47:33
Matthias
Hallo Onur,
ja, ich bin sicher, die Zuschläge sind so in einem Haustarif mit der IG Metall geregelt. Feiertage habe ich hier extra mal rausgenommen.
LG, Matthias
AW: Lohnzuschläge ermitteln nach Uhrzeiten und Tag
08.10.2019 17:55:48
onur
Aber im Tarifvertrag steht bestimmt nicht so eine Tabelle wie Deine, sondern eindeutige Regeln:
Sonntagszuschlag xy% von: bis:
Nachtzuschlag xy% von: bis: usw usw.
DIESE Regeln brauchen wir und nicht so eine Tabelle für 1 Stunde, 3 Stunden usw.
Anzeige
AW: Lohnzuschläge ermitteln nach Uhrzeiten und Tag
09.10.2019 10:06:59
Matthias
Hier die Regeln als Text:
Bei Mehrarbeit fallen folgende Zuschläge auf die vereinbarten Basissätze an:
Montag bis Freitag ab der 2.Überstunde
o für die erste Überstunde (am Tag die 8. Stunde) 25%
o für die weiteren Überstunden 50%
Nachtzuschlag von 22:00 bis 06:00 Uhr 25%
Samstags für die ersten beiden Stunden 25%
Samstags ab der 3. Stunde 40%
Samstags ab der 7. Stunde 50%
Sonntag 50%
Feiertag 150%
Anzeige
AW: Lohnzuschläge ermitteln nach Uhrzeiten und Tag
09.10.2019 10:29:06
Daniel
Hi
ich schätze mal, das wird mit reinen Excelformeln schwierig, weil du im Prinzip jede einzelne Stunde prüfen musst und dabei eine ganze Reihe von Bedingungen prüfen musst, welche Teilweise auch noch aufeinander aufbauen.
hier müsstet du dir wahrscheinlich mit VBA was programmieren.
Gruß Daniel
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Lohnzuschläge ermitteln nach Uhrzeiten und Tag


Schritt-für-Schritt-Anleitung

  1. Datenstruktur erstellen: Lege eine Excel-Tabelle an, die die gewünschten Spalten für von, bis, Pausenzeit und die Konditionen enthält. Die Konditionen sollten die verschiedenen Zuschläge enthalten, z.B. für Nacht, Samstag und Sonntag.

  2. Zuschläge definieren: Erstelle eine separate Tabelle für die Zuschläge. Diese Tabelle könnte wie folgt aussehen:

    | Beginn     | Ende       | 0:00 | 3:00 | 7:00 | 8:00 | 9:00 |
    |------------|------------|------|------|------|------|------|
    | Mo 00:00  | Mo 05:59   | 1,25 | 1,25 | 1,25 | 1,25 | 1,50 |
    | Mo 06:00  | Mo 21:59   | 1,00 | 1,00 | 1,00 | 1,25 | 1,50 |
    | ...        | ...        | ...  | ...  | ...  | ...  | ...  |
  3. Formel zur Berechnung: Nutze die Excel-Funktion WVERWEIS oder SVERWEIS, um die Zuschläge basierend auf den Arbeitszeiten zu ermitteln. Beispiel:

    =WVERWEIS(DATUM; TabelleZuschläge; Spalte; FALSCH)
  4. Bedingungen erfassen: Berücksichtige die Bedingungen für Zuschläge, z.B. ab welcher Uhrzeit Nachtschichtzuschlag anfällt. Für die IG Metall gelten die folgenden Zuschläge:

    • Nachtzuschlag von 22:00 bis 06:00 Uhr: 25%
    • Samstagszuschlag für die ersten beiden Stunden: 25%
    • Sonntagszuschlag: 50%
  5. Überstunden auswerten: Berechne die Überstunden anhand der festgelegten Werte in der IG Metall Überstundenzuschlag Tabelle. Beispiel für eine Überstunde:

    =WENN(Arbeitsstunden > 8; (Arbeitsstunden - 8) * 1,5; 0)
  6. Ergebnisse zusammenfassen: Addiere alle Zuschläge und Überstunden, um die Gesamtsumme zu ermitteln.


Häufige Fehler und Lösungen

  • Fehler bei den Zeitangaben: Stelle sicher, dass die Zeitangaben im korrekten Format (hh:mm) vorliegen. Andernfalls können Berechnungen fehlerhaft sein.

  • Zuschläge nicht korrekt berechnet: Überprüfe, ob die Bedingungen in den Formeln korrekt sind. Nutze die WENN-Funktion, um verschiedene Szenarien abzudecken.

  • Falsche Zuordnung von Zuschlägen: Achte darauf, dass die Übergänge zwischen den Tagen (z.B. von Samstag auf Sonntag) korrekt berücksichtigt werden.


Alternative Methoden

  • VBA zur Automatisierung: Wenn Du regelmäßig mit Zuschlägen arbeiten musst, kann es sinnvoll sein, ein VBA-Skript zu erstellen, das die Berechnungen automatisiert und verschiedene Szenarien berücksichtigt.

  • Pivot-Tabellen: Nutze Pivot-Tabellen, um die Daten zu analysieren und die Zuschläge schnell zu berechnen.


Praktische Beispiele

  • Beispiel 1: Ein Mitarbeiter beginnt am Samstag um 22:00 Uhr und endet am Sonntag um 07:00 Uhr. Berechne die Zuschläge:

    • Nachtzuschlag: 25% für 22:00 - 00:00
    • Samstagszuschlag: 25% für 22:00 - 00:00
    • Sonntagszuschlag: 50% für 00:00 - 07:00
  • Beispiel 2: Ein Mitarbeiter hat am Freitag von 17:00 bis 23:00 Uhr gearbeitet. Die Berechnung für den Freitag würde wie folgt aussehen:

    • Normalstunden: 5 Stunden
    • Überstunden ab 8 Stunden: 0, da nur 5 Stunden gearbeitet wurden.

Tipps für Profis

  • Nutzung von Excel-Formeln: Vertraue auf die SUMMEWENN und SUMMEWENNS Funktionen, um die Zuschläge effizient zu summieren.

  • Bedingte Formatierungen: Setze bedingte Formatierungen ein, um die verschiedenen Zuschläge visuell hervorzuheben.

  • Zugriff auf IG Metall Tabellen: Halte die aktuellen IG Metall Zuschläge Tabellen griffbereit, um sicherzustellen, dass Du die korrekten Sätze verwendest.


FAQ: Häufige Fragen

1. Ab welcher Uhrzeit gilt der Nachtschichtzuschlag?
Der Nachtschichtzuschlag gilt von 22:00 bis 06:00 Uhr.

2. Wie berechne ich die Zuschläge in Excel?
Verwende die genannten Excel-Formeln und achte darauf, die richtigen Bedingungen in Deine Berechnungen einzufügen.

3. Wo finde ich die IG Metall Zuschläge Tabelle?
Die IG Metall Zuschläge Tabelle findest Du auf der offiziellen Website oder in den Tarifverträgen.

4. Was ist der Unterschied zwischen Überstunden- und Nachtschichtzuschlag?
Überstunden werden für Stunden berechnet, die über die vertraglich festgelegte Arbeitszeit hinausgehen, während Nachtschichtzuschläge für Arbeiten in der Nacht gelten.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ige